Heat Pump Repair Cost in Tacoma, WA
| Service |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Diagnostic & minor repair | $149 – $450 |
| Defrost board replacement | $300 – $600 |
| Reversing valve repair | $500 – $1,200 |
| Refrigerant leak repair | $400 – $1,000 |
Estimates vary based on system condition, home layout, and equipment brand. $149 service call covers diagnostic & basic repairs. Get an accurate quote for your Tacoma home — no obligation.

Heat pump not heating in Downtown Tacoma, Tacoma
Common causes: stuck reversing valve, low refrigerant, failed defrost board, or auxiliary heat strips not engaging. We test all heat pump modes including emergency heat.
Heat pump iced over in Downtown Tacoma, Tacoma
Ice buildup in winter signals a defrost cycle problem — usually a failed defrost board or sensor. We restore proper defrost cycling so your unit stays clear all winter.
Heat pump making loud noises in Downtown Tacoma, Tacoma
Grinding, screeching, or rattling typically point to compressor, fan motor, or contactor issues. We diagnose before damage spreads to the compressor — the most expensive part.
Heat pump running constantly in Downtown Tacoma, Tacoma
Could be undersized capacity, low refrigerant, dirty coils, or thermostat issues. We measure system performance and pinpoint why it can't reach setpoint.

Common HVAC Issues in Downtown Tacoma, Tacoma
Dirty filters reducing system efficiency
Clogged filters force your HVAC system to work harder, increasing energy bills by 15% or more. Downtown Tacoma, Tacoma homeowners should replace filters every 1-3 months.
Thermostat calibration problems
Improperly calibrated thermostats cause temperature swings and wasted energy. Smart thermostat upgrades pay for themselves within one Downtown Tacoma, Tacoma heating season.
Aging equipment nearing end of life
HVAC systems in Downtown Tacoma, Tacoma typically last 15-20 years. Units over 12 years old should be evaluated for efficiency — modern systems use 30-50% less energy.
Uneven temperatures between rooms
Hot and cold spots in Downtown Tacoma, Tacoma homes often indicate duct leaks, poor insulation, or an improperly sized system. A professional load calculation identifies the root cause.
